The problem is probably this dependency: <dependency> <groupId>org.apache.kafka</groupId> <artifactId>kafka_2.9.1</artifactId> <version>0.8.2.0</version> </dependency>
Since it pulls Scala 2.9. You can probably remove this dependency because our kafka connector will also pull also that kafka dependency.
